While Gautama Buddha ,on seeing suffering all over and Tulasidas ,awakened by a mere taunting from his wife,are true examples of instant dawn of enlightenment and ‘victory over oneself’,A hint on the right approach,in such cases is given in the Bible (Matthew: 26,41), “The spirit indeed is willing but the flesh is weak”.Yes, determining to progress towards one’s objectives and spirituality would be of no avail unless other ingredients,so necessary are first taken care of — physical health, energy, exuberance and sustaining power, which go with it.In any enterprise involving self-transformation , belief is the bottom line. Beliefs though aren’t immutable.
In short, the body is the route to all mental refinement. The reason for this, as noted by William James, is that body and thus physical activities can be more easily regulated , being under direct control of the will. In this manner, feelings and mind, which are not under this direct control , are also influenced and inspired, though indirectly. A renowned cardiologist also points out how a brisk walk “may be more helpful”.Experience the gentleness and joy all over as you go for a walk, feel the water trickling down, as you shower, cleansing, as if, your body and mind too.
